Every Oracle release tends to feel like the last one. Finance, HCM, Supply Chain — something changes, and the QA team runs the full regression suite again because nobody's quite sure what the update actually touched. It's slow, it eats people's weeks, and defects still find a way through to production. Most teams know they're testing too much in some places and not enough in others. They just don't have a good way to tell which is which.
That's the gap GoTestPro AI Impact Analysis fills. It's an AI-powered, no-code test automation framework that looks at what actually changed in an Oracle release and points your testing at the parts that need it. Targeted. Risk-driven. A lot less guesswork. You stop spending three days re-running tests on workflows Oracle didn't touch, and you stop hoping the critical approval path still works because nobody had time to check.
Underneath, there's the rest of the platform doing the unglamorous work — pre-built Oracle scenarios you don't have to write from scratch, codeless authoring, auto-healing when the UI shifts under you, and one place to cover both UI and API. The point isn't that any one of these is novel. It's that together they turn Oracle release testing from a recurring crisis into something predictable, and your team gets confidence in the workflows that actually matter to the business.
